How We Work
1
Emergency Contact
Your urgent call initiates our rapid response. We gather critical information, assess the water damage over the phone, and dispatch a certified team to your Sugar Land location immediately to prevent further damage.
2
On-Site Assessment
Upon arrival, our technicians use moisture meters and thermal imaging to accurately map the extent of water intrusion. This detailed inspection informs our comprehensive drying plan and prepares for water extraction.
3
Water Extraction & Drying
High-powered pumps and industrial-grade extractors remove standing water. We then strategically place dehumidifiers and air movers to thoroughly dry affected areas, preventing mold growth and preparing for restoration.
4
Cleaning & Sanitizing
Contaminated materials are safely removed. We apply antimicrobial treatments to sanitize all surfaces, ensuring a clean and healthy environment. This step ensures readiness for structural repairs and reconstruction.
5
Restoration & Final Walkthrough
Our skilled craftsmen repair or replace damaged building materials, restoring your property to its pre-damage condition. A final walkthrough ensures your complete satisfaction with our work and the restored space.

Warning Signs You Need Sprinkler System Water Removal

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don't ignore these warning signs; they're a clear indication that you need professional help right away.

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

Strong, persistent musty odors are a clear sign of water damage. If you notice these odors in your home, it's essential to act quickly to prevent mold growth and further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ring is a sign of water damage that can spread quickly. Our team can help you identify the root cause of the problem and develop a plan to get your floors back to normal.

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ls are a clear indication of a leak or water damage. Don't ignore these signs; they can lead to costly repairs and potential mold growth.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ks in your sprinkler system are a clear sign of a problem. Our team can help you identify the root cause of the issue and develop a plan to get your system back to normal.

Water Bills That Are Higher Than Usual

Water bills that are higher than usual can be a sign of a leak or water damage. Our team can help you identify the root cause of the problem and develop a plan to get your water bills back to normal.

Sprinkler System Water Removal Cost In Mission Bend, TX

Prices for Sprinkler System Water Removal can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Mission Bend, TX. These are estimates, not guarantees. Our team will provide a customized quote based on your unique situ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al and Drying $500 - $2,500 Severity of damage and size of affected area
Insulation and Drywall Repair $1,000 - $5,000 Amount of damaged insulation and drywall
Equipment Rental and Labor $1,500 - $3,000 Size of affected area and complexity of job
Final Inspection and Cleanup $200 - $1,000 Size of affected area and complexity of job
Insurance Claims and Documentation $0 - $1,000 Complexity of insurance claims and documentation

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. Our team offers free estimates for Sprinkler System Water Removal in Mission Bend, TX.
